(^) Section 309(c) of such Act is amended— (1) by inserting after "licensee", the first place it appears, the following: "and any other person"; (2) by striking out "inform the licensee" and inserting in lieu thereof the following: "set forth"; (3) by inserting after "licensee", the last place it appears, the following: "and any other person involved"; and (4) by inserting before "suspending", each place it appears, the following: "revoking or". (e) Section 309(e) of such Act is amended by inserting after "licensee", the first place it appears, the following: ", or other person against whom an order is issued,". (f) Section 309(f) of such Act is amended— (1) by striking out the first sentence and inserting in lieu thereof the following: "If any licensee or other person against which or against whom an order is issued under this section fails to obey the order, the Administration may apply to the United States court of appeals, within the circuit where the licensee has its principal place of business, for the enforcement of the order, and shall file a transcript of the record upon which the order complained of was entered."; and (2) by inserting "or other person" before the period at the end of the second sentence. gj,(,_ 5_ Section 310 of the Small Business Investment Act of 1958 is amended— (1) by striking out the section heading and inserting in lieu thereof "EXAMINATIONS AND INVESTIGATIONS"; and (2) by inserting " (a) " after "SEC. 310.", and by adding at the end thereof a new subsection as follows: " (b) Each small business investment company shall be subject to examinations made by direction of the Administration by examiners selected or approved by the Administration, and the cost of such examinations, including the compensation of the examiners, may in the discretion of the Administration be assessed against the company examined and when so assessed shall be paid by such company. Every such company shall make such reports to the Administration at such times and in such form as the Administration may require; except that the Administration is authorized to exempt from making such reports any such company which is registered under the Investment Company Act of 1940 to the extent necessary to avoid duplication in reporting requirements." ^^^' ^- Section 311 of the Small Business Investment Act of 1958 is amended by adding at the end thereof the following new subsection: "(c) The Administration shall have authority to act as trustee or receiver of the licensee. Upon request by the Administration, the court may appoint the Administration to act in such capacity unless the court deems such appointment inequitable or otherwise inappropriate by reason of the special circumstances involved." SEC. 7. Title III of the Small Business Investment Act of 1958 is further amended by adding at the end thereof the following new sections:
